7/8/25 - (Taps & Barrels Beerhouse) (Las Vegas, Nevada) Bar Notes: Comped with Nevada Passport discount, 5.3% ABV.

Appearance: 14 oz draft served in a shaker pint glass. Foggy unfiltered yellow straw base, thin white head and generous thin white lacing. 3.75

Aroma: Lemon, pine, citrus dankness, medium strength. Digging. 4.25

Taste: Consistent with the aroma, pine, citrus lemon. Almost shandy like with lemonade vibes. Nice on an over 100 F day. 4.25

Mouthfeel: Light and easy, faint slightly prickly carbonation. Drinks a bit above the 5.3% ABV. Dank, lightly bitter, balanced, pine lemon start to finish. 4.0

Overall: This is a solid Pale Ale, light body, strong pleasant blend. Would enjoy this again if given the chance. 4.25

Look - plays the west coast part, though with a strong yellow clear amber effect, good CO2 effect, not much head, some decent lacing.

Smell/Aroma - Citrus, blueberry dankness, a bit of that good ol' cat pee that I enjoy on the nose. Good tropical and floral notes but still a bit old school on the nose.

Taste - Deliciously old school bitter profile on the palate, nice tart citrust bite, then a rounder -berry note on the back end from the balance of Citra and Mosaic in this.

F - Maybe too smooth? Doesn't leave a giant palate impression, and that's fine at 5.3% but it's also not that 'distinct' a beer.

O - Another solid West Coast pale ale that reminds me of some old school pale ales of yesteryear but with more care, balance, and a lean towards a nice, dry, bitter finish. Dig it.
